Effective Butynol Roof Repair Methods
Choose the right repair method based on your damage type. Professional butynol roof repairs experts can help determine the best approach.
Patch Repairs
Best for small holes, punctures, and localized damage. Uses butynol patches adhered with compatible adhesive. Most common method for minor butynol roof repairs.
Best for: Small holes, punctures, isolated damage
Liquid Membrane Overlay
Liquid butynol or compatible coating applied over existing membrane. Creates seamless waterproof layer. Excellent for aging roofs needing extensive butynol roof repairs.
Best for: Aging roofs, multiple small cracks, preventive maintenance
Seam Re-Sealing
Addresses seam separation and edge lifting with specialized sealants. Critical for maintaining watertight integrity of butynol roof repairs.
Best for: Seam failures, edge lifting, joint issues
Step-by-Step Butynol Roof Repair Process
Follow these steps for effective butynol roof repairs. When in doubt, contact professionals.
Inspect & Identify the Damage
Thorough inspection is the first step in effective butynol roof repairs. Look for cracks, bubbles, seam separation, and areas of water pooling. Mark all damaged spots.
Clean the Repair Area
Clean the damaged area thoroughly with a suitable cleaner. Remove dirt, debris, moss, and any loose material. The surface must be completely dry for butynol roof repairs to work.
Apply Primer (If Required)
Some butynol roof repairs require primer application for proper adhesion. Check manufacturer guidelines for your specific repair method.
Apply Patch or Sealant
Apply butynol patch, liquid membrane, or sealant depending on the damage type. Ensure proper overlap and full coverage for lasting butynol roof repairs.
Allow Proper Curing
Let the repair cure fully before exposing to weather. Most butynol roof repairs need 24-48 hours to cure completely.
